KNOCKHILL BSB: RUTTER EXPECTING PODIUMS IN SCOTLAND

Worx Suzuki's Michael Rutter reckons he is capable of standing on the British Superbike podium at Knockhill this weekend after finding a good front end setup at Snetterton.

Even though the Midlander didn't capitalise on the new feel at the Norfolk track, Rutter says that the GSX-R1000 has all the right attributes to run at the front all weekend.

“We made great progress with the set-up at Snetterton, although as that wasn’t reflected in the results few would know. But coming to Knockhill it’s an all new game," he said.

"I love Knockhill and I showed that last year by standing on the podium. You see, this place is short and tight yet because of the start straight and the sweeping run into the hairpin it still has a very fast lap speed, around 95mph.

"So you need a bike that you can confidently turn very very quickly but also has a super-strong motor. The GSX-R1000 has all of this. So, no question, I’m looking to qualify front row and make the podium this weekend.”
